Оператор ВЫЧИСЛИТЬ ВНУТРИ МАССИВА (продолжение)

Оценить
(0 голоса)

Рассмотрим второй вариант оператора ВЫЧИСЛИТЬ ВНУТРИ МАССИВА. Этот вариант позволяет последовательно с нарастающим итогом накапливать значения величин-функций по записям с одинаковыми значениями ключа.

Пример 1. Имеется массив М4. В этом массиве нужно вычислить с накоплением по ключу ШИФР МАТЕРИАЛА величину СУММАРНЫЙ РАСХОД, равную сумме значений величины РАСХОД МАТЕРИАЛА. Искомая величина представлена в массиве М5.

Заметим, что при решении задач с применением оператора ВЫЧИСЛИТЬ ВНУТРИ МАССИВА (второй вариант) исходный массив обязательно должен быть упорядочен по ключу, по которому производится вычисление. Этот ключ может быть простым, как в приведенном примере, и может быть сложным. В последнем случае массив должен быть упорядочен по сложному ключу.

Пример 2. Имеется массив М4. В этом массиве требуется вычислить с накоплением по ключу ШИФР МАТЕРИАЛА, НОМЕР ЦЕХА величину СУММАРНЫЙ РАСХОД, равную сумме значений величины РАСХОД МАТЕРИАЛА.

Искомая величина
Удельный вес материальных затрат
Анализ задачи обработки данных для ее уточнения
Понятие об уточненном условии задачи ОД
Переход от таблицы к массиву

Добавить комментарий


Защитный код
Обновить